The Tactical Shift in Chemin de Fer

Chemin de Fer stands as one of the oldest and most engaging versions of baccarat, widely favored by traditionalists across Europe. Unlike standard casino formats where the house manages all financial risks, players take turns acting as the banker and actively competing against each other. This dynamic setup introduces a profound psychological element as participants decide whether to draw a third card based on their opponent's visible hands.

The shifting responsibility around the table ensures that no two rounds play out exactly the same way. It requires an active understanding of table dynamics and individual bankroll management since the banker directly faces the collective wagers of the room. For those who enjoy active decision-making rather than passive betting, this classic variation provides a deeply satisfying challenge.

Testing Speed and Control in Baccarat Banque

Baccarat Banque shares historical roots with Chemin de Fer but alters the banking structure to create a highly intense environment. In this version, the position of the banker is much more permanent and is typically awarded to the player willing to risk the largest initial stake. The designated banker maintains this role throughout the entire shoe unless their funds are completely depleted by the table.

This structure creates an exceptional test of endurance and risk management for the individual controlling the bank. The other players are divided into two separate halves of the table, allowing them to collaborate or wager independently against the bank's dominant position. Mastering this format requires a strong grasp of betting limits and a willingness to withstand significant financial swings.

Navigating the Modern Twist of EZ Baccarat

For modern enthusiasts looking for a variant that eliminates traditional friction, EZ Baccarat offers an intriguing mathematical adjustment. This popular variation removes the standard five percent commission typically charged on winning banker wagers, speeding up the gameplay significantly. However, a specific rule dictates that if the banker hand wins with a three-card total of seven, the wager results in a push rather than a payout.

This subtle adjustment completely changes the mathematical landscape and introduces optional side bets that track these specific outcomes. Embracing the Intensity of Super 6 Baccarat

Super 6 Baccarat is another commission-free variant that has gained immense popularity in contemporary gaming halls and live dealer platforms. Similar to EZ Baccarat, it offers full payouts on banker wins unless the hand hits a highly specific number. If the banker wins the round with a total score of exactly six, the payout is reduced to fifty percent of the original wager.

This rule forces players to carefully balance their risk profiles and weigh the utility of insurance side bets. The sudden reduction in payouts on a six creates a dramatic tension that is completely absent from standard versions of the game.
